Taxonomic Classification

Rank Black-fronted Duiker brown woolly monkey
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class same Mammalia (Mammals)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Artiodactyla (Even-toed Ungulates) Primates (Primates)
Family Bovidae (Bovids) Atelidae
Genus Cephalophus Lagothrix
Species Cephalophus nigrifrons Lagothrix lagothricha

Evolutionary Relationship

Black-fronted Duiker and brown woolly monkey share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Mammals)
